Understanding the Rise of Live Casino Gaming

Live casino gaming integrates real-time streaming technology, professional dealers, and sophisticated user interfaces to create immersive gambling experiences accessible via desktop and mobile devices. According to industry reports, the global live dealer market was valued at approximately USD 10 billion in 2022 and is forecasted to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 12% through 2030 (source: Global Market Insights). This surge reflects increasing player demand for authenticity, social interaction, and convenience.

Strategic Implications for Operators

Technological Innovation and User Engagement

To remain competitive, operators are leveraging cutting-edge streaming technology, advanced RNG integrations, and multi-angle camera setups to enhance authenticity. The integration of aug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R) is also on the horizon, promising even more immersive experiences.

Regulatory and Licensing Challenges

As live casino platforms expand, navigating the complex regulatory landscape becomes paramount. Jurisdiction-specific licensing, player protections, and responsible gambling protocols must be seamlessly integrated into operational strategies.
